Question: You are to design, write, assemble, and simulate an assembly language program which will generate the square of a number N by calculating the following

You are to design, write, assemble, and simulate an assembly language program which will generate
the square of a number N by calculating the following sum:
N
2=1+3+5+7+9+...+(2N-1), with 1<= N <=255
Given to you is N as a 1-byte unsigned integer variable with 1<= N <=255. Your program has to
calculate the square of N as a 2-byte number to be stored in variable RESULT in BIG-ENDIAN
format. For example, if N=255, your answer should be $FE01(the two-byte hex equivalent of
65025).

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Programming Questions!